Konami has finally given Dewy's Adventure a Japanese release date. This new Wii title from the minds behind the critically-acclaimed Elebits will be hitting Japanese retail outlets on July 26.

Dewy's Adventure is the story of a little drop of water that could. In the game, players take control of Dewy, a water droplet who must find a way to save his Elder Tree who has fallen ill at the hands of the evil Don Hedron. Players will use the Wii remote to navigate by tilting it to position Dewy in the right spots for some puzzle-solving action.

Dewy can also change the temperature of his immediate surroundings. He can turn into ice or mist, for example. Players can also cause earthquakes and lightning bolts by shaking and waving the Wiimote in certain situations. For more cute blob action, check out this trailer.
